Four Seasons residents, beware of the coming spring allergy
season. Allergies may start once wild owers or plants begin to
bloom. All over the Banning Pass and on the desert oor in the
Morongo Valley, Joshua Tree, and Twentynine Palms, sensitivity
to wildowers or blooming plants causes coughing, sneezing, a
runny nose, and itchy eyes. I have struggled with allergies all of
my life. I believe that controlling them comes down to consistent
treatment. Taking a 24-hour allergy pill like Allegra, Claritin, or
Zyrtec helps.
Allergy pills need to be in your system for at least two weeks
before they become eective. Over-the-counter medications
are good but they may cause drowsiness and dry sinuses. Sinus
inhalers can help control the swelling of your nasal passages. is
allows you to breathe freely and easily through your nose, which
should be the goal.
It would be easy if allergies could be like our name, Four
Seasons, but we do not have the luxury of a dened allergy season
in Southern California. Dened seasons may allow you to ease
up on your treatment. Here in the Banning Pass, sporadic rain
may lead to early or late springs. If you try and stop your allergy
treatments, it may backre and leave you congested and miserable
all over again. All of us want to enjoy a healthy retirement.
Keeping a regular treatment schedule should keep congestion and
sinus pain at bay. Without allergies we can all hope to fully enjoy
the beauty of the spring season.
